Cobham & Stoke d'Abernon station provides a range of facilities to enhance your travel experience. The ticket office is operational from Monday to Friday between 06:20 and 13:15, and on Saturdays from 08:00 to 14:00. For quick and easy ticket purchases, there are ticket machines available, which also support the collection of tickets bought online. In addition, accessible ticket machines ensure that passengers can purchase their tickets with ease, accommodating those with a Disabled Persons Railcard. The station is also equipped with smartcard validators, catering to the modern commuter.
While the Cobham & Stoke d'Abernon station doesn't offer staff help, there are customer help points and heated waiting rooms available during ticket office hours for your convenience. The station also prides itself on having step-free access, although this might be limited to certain areas; hence, it’s wise to plan your visit ahead if you require access support.
The station is fitted with essential services such as public Wi-Fi and payphones. While it lacks in ATMs and extensive shopping options, the available café can cater to your refreshment needs as you wait for your train. For those considering a biking journey, the station offers ample bicycle storage with 88 spaces, though no hire facilities exist.
The venue shines when it comes to parking, offering 264 spaces complete with CCTV coverage for security. Blue Badge holders can find complimentary parking, provided they register appropriately. For further details on parking options, charges, and Blue Badge registration, you can explore more on the South Western Railway website.

Heyford Train Station provides a minimalistic experience in terms of facilities. Travelers won’t find a ticket office or ticket machines, highlighting the importance of purchasing your tickets online beforehand. For those requiring assistance, a help point is available with staff providing on-the-go information. Visual aids such as departure screens and announcements can guide your journey, even though there are no waiting rooms or baggage storage options.
Accessibility is partly accommodated with step-free access available only to certain platforms. Travelers are advised to tread carefully due to the absence of tactile paving. Unfortunately, the station lacks facilities such as toilets, refreshment outlets, and an ATM, making it advisable to plan accordingly before your visit.
